Renaissance faires

Travel America,  May-June, 2004  by Pat Woods

Each spring and summer Renaissance festival grounds throughout the country come alive weekends with the clink of armor, thump of horse hooves, and delightful aroma of cinnamon and roasting turkey legs. Often located outside cities, the fairs offer discounts, enabling seniors to step into the 16th Century to experience dozens of costumed village characters, knights on horseback, damsels, fools, villains, and artisans.
